Vasilyev Keeps His Foot on the Gas

Level 5 : 200/400, 400 ante

Vladimir Vasilyev raised to 900 from under-the-gun and was called by a player in middle position. The cutoff-player made it 4,100 to go and both players called.

After both players checked over to the cutoff-player on the {a-Spades}{5-Hearts}{2-Clubs} flop, he continued for 2,700. With action back on Vasilyev he check-raised to 6,300, which got a fold from the middle-position player and a call from the cutoff-player. Vasilyev then led out with a bet of 10,500 on the {10-Hearts} turn, took down the pot and added to his stack, which has more than doubled since the start of the tournament.
